two water tanks are leaking water. the equation and the table each represent the gallons of water in the tank, y, as a function of time in minutes, x. how much water does tank a hold before it starts to leak? find the initial value. tank a: y = 900 - 11x 900 gallons tank b: how much water does tank b hold before it starts to leak? find the initial value. minutes, x | water in tank (gal), y 0 | 985 1 | 975 2 | 965 3 | 955 985 gallons which tank holds more water before it starts to leak? tank b holds? water than tank a before the tanks start to leak.
Step1: Compare initial values
Tank A's initial value (when \( x = 0 \)) from \( y = 900 - 11x \) is \( y = 900 \) gallons. Tank B's initial value (from the table, \( x = 0 \)) is 985 gallons.
Step2: Determine the relationship
Since \( 985>900 \), Tank B has more water than Tank A initially. The difference is \( 985 - 900 = 85 \), but the question asks for the comparative term (more/less). As 985 > 900, Tank B holds more water.
